Output 89109177a90bee5937425ae8b983bf811571e185ed180f44d571b1ff533bae91:17

value
37338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3af399b3e781f2864b1395c14328b697876b346 OP_EQUAL
address
3LzJQsJj4hwP5czJNSJMYEyPJbUUCpwSwM
transaction
89109177a90bee5937425ae8b983bf811571e185ed180f44d571b1ff533bae91
spent
true